What are the responsibilities and job description for the Assistant Property Manager position at Priderock Capital Management?
We are seeking a dedicated and organized Assistant Property Manager to support the daily operations of our property management team in Pembroke Pines, FL. The ideal candidate will possess strong administrative skills and a customer-focused mindset, ensuring that our residents receive exceptional service. This role involves assisting with property management tasks, maintaining tenant relationships, and contributing to the overall success of the property.
Duties:
- Assist in managing day-to-day operations of the property, ensuring compliance with company policies and procedures.
- Maintain accurate records and files related to tenant information, lease agreements, and property maintenance.
- Oversite and management of Occupancy, Delinquency, Renewals and new leases
- Utilize property management software such as Yardi for tracking tenant accounts, processing applications, and managing work orders.
- Provide excellent customer service by addressing tenant inquiries and resolving issues in a timely manner.
- Support leasing efforts by conducting property tours, processing rental applications, and following up with prospective tenants.
- Collaborate with the Property Manager on budgeting, reporting, and financial tracking related to the property’s performance.
- Ensure that the property is well-maintained by coordinating maintenance requests and inspections.
- Assist in marketing efforts to attract new tenants through social media and community outreach initiatives.
